Award-winning theatre and film director, producer and writer Alan Lyddiard is involved in a Leeds 2023 project that he says “resonates across the world”.

The 73-year-old has worked across the UK, Europe and beyond. He set up The Performance Ensemble in 2015 to create high quality contemporary performances with people over 60, drawing on their life experiences, hopes and fears, for audiences of all ages.

Now the group are working on a new project for Leeds 2023 and they want anyone over 60 to get involved. Here, he tells us more about it:
